Walgreens is well-known for its array of promotions and special offers designed to help customers save on everything from prescriptions to everyday essentials. For locals in Knoxville, leveraging these offers can make a significant difference in their shopping budget. Key ways to find savings include:
myWalgreens Rewards Program: This free loyalty program is central to saving at Walgreens. Members earn Walgreens Cash rewards on most purchases (including a higher percentage on Walgreens-branded products), receive personalized digital coupons, and often get bonus rewards for specific purchases or health activities like prescription refills or immunizations. Walgreens Cash can then be redeemed like cash on future purchases.
Weekly Ad Deals: A new weekly ad is released every Sunday, featuring limited-time sales, "Buy One Get One Free" (BOGO) offers, and percentage-off deals across various departments (health, beauty, household, snacks, etc.). These are available in print in-store and digitally on their website and app.
Digital Coupons via the App: The Walgreens mobile app is a powerhouse for savings. Customers can easily clip digital coupons directly to their myWalgreens account, which automatically apply at checkout. The app also provides exclusive discounts and personalized offers.
Senior Day Discounts: Walgreens often offers a specific "Senior Day" once a month, providing a percentage off eligible items for seniors. The exact day can vary, so checking their website or in-store signage is advisable.
Photo Deals: Frequent promotions on photo services are common, including discounts on prints, enlargements, photo books, and custom gifts. Look for codes for online orders or in-store specials.
Prescription Savings Programs (e.g., RxLess, GoodRx): While not directly a Walgreens promotion, they partner with programs like GoodRx and RxLess, allowing customers to use free coupons or discount cards to significantly reduce the cost of many prescriptions, regardless of insurance coverage.
Clearance Items: Keep an eye out for clearance sections within the store, where items are marked down significantly for quick sale.
Curbside Pickup and Delivery Offers: Walgreens frequently offers promotions like free 1-hour delivery on qualifying orders or discounts for using curbside pickup services.

For any inquiries regarding prescriptions, store hours, product availability, or to speak with the team at Walgreens on Chapman Highway in Knoxville, you can use the following contact details:
Address: 4001 Chapman Hwy, Knoxville, TN 37920, USA
Phone: (865) 573-0081
It's important to note the specific hours for different departments. While the main retail store is open 24 hours a day, every day, the pharmacy has more limited hours. The pharmacy generally operates from 8:00 AM to 10:00 PM Monday through Friday, and 10:00 AM to 6:00 PM on Saturdays and Sundays. The pharmacy also typically closes for a meal break, usually from 1:30 PM to 2:00 PM. It is always a good practice to call ahead or check their official website for the most current pharmacy hours, especially on holidays or before a critical visit.
